About Laura Biganzoli

Laura Biganzoli is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Oncology, Geriatrics and Gerontology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, having authored 226 papers that have together received 7.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(93 papers),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(89 papers), H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(55 papers), Advanced Breast Cancer Therapies (46 papers), Colorectal Cancer Treatments and Studies (18 papers), Metabolomics and Mass Spectrometry Studies (15 papers),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(15 papers) and Recycling and Waste Management Techniques (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(2.6k citations), Oncology (4.4k cit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(364 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(1.6k citations) and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(300 citations). Laura Biganzoli has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Belgium and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Wederson M. Claudino, Angelo Di Leo, Martine Piccart, Mario Grosso, Matti Aapro, Lucia Rigamonti, Robert Paridaens, Marta Pestrin, Robert E. Coleman and Catherine Oakman.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, European Journal of Cancer, Annals of Oncology, The Breast and Cancer Research.
